The Immaculate Heart of Mary School is a historic school building on the campus of the Immaculate Heart of Mary Church in northern Pulaski County, Arkansas. It is located off Arkansas Highway 365, north of North Little Rock and east of Marche. The building is a single-story wood-frame building with Craftsman styling. It has a gable-on-hip roof with a front porch supported by square brick columns, with false timbering applied over vertical boards in the gable end. The building was built in 1925 by the church's head carpenter, George Makowski.
